The Prospects for the Application of Wear-Resistant Perforated Anti-Slip Plates on Work Platforms in Canadian Industrial Buildings
2026-04-28
The operating platforms in Canadian industrial buildings are subject to complex environments and place stringent demands on flooring materials. When used on these platforms, wear-resistant perforated anti-slip panels offer the durability required to withstand the wear and tear caused by equipment operation, tool placement and foot traffic. Their anti-slip properties provide workers with a safe surface for standing and walking, thereby preventing slip-and-fall accidents. The perforated design facilitates the removal of oil, metal shavings and other debris, helping to keep the platform clean and improve work efficiency, and thus holds promising prospects for application.
